Kelly Mills Ltd was wound up on 22nd August 2020.

 

Kelly Mills Ltd

Trial Balance

as at 22nd August 2020

 

Debit

Credit

Cash

$46 800

 

Inventories

981 760

 

Plant and equipment

1 099 280

 

Land and buildings

312 000

 

Accumulated losses

420 160

 

Accounts payable

 

$832 000

Alliance Bank mortgage loan (secured on land and buildings)

 

208 000

Share capital: 1 820 000 ordinary shares issued for $1 each, fully paid

 

.               .

 

1 820 000

 

$2 860 000

$2 860 000

 

 

The following information is relevant

 

(a) The assets were sold and realised the following cash amounts:

 

                         Inventories                                                 $624 000

                         Plant and machinery                                $728 000

 

(b) The Alliance Bank took possession of the land and buildings, sold them for $468 000 and after the debt was cleared paid any excess funds to the liquidator.

 

(c) Liquidation costs were $98 800.

 

(d) The liquidator paid all liabilities.

 

 

Required

Prepare the JOURNAL ENTRIES to wind up the affairs of Kelly Mills Ltd and to calculate any deficiency and distribution to the shareholders.
